The most dazzling Premier Christmas Light Installation
Dive into the wonder of the season with Greenwood Village's top-rated Christmas light installation. Residents will be enchanted by a dazzling display of seasonal cheer that transforms the neighborhood. Thousands of twinkling lights illuminate homes, creating a picturesque winter wonderland. Be sure to check out the grand illumination ceremony Enj